实际上,说IPFS协议代替HTTP是不准确的,它应该是互补的。IPFS至少在此阶段使HTTP成为补充,减少了带宽需求,并使内容分发更安全。
让我们首先谈谈IPFS和HTTP之间的区别。
1)安全性:HTTP是集中式的,所有流量都直接在集中式服务器上承载。负载非常重,很容易导致系统崩溃。HTTP也容易受到DDOS攻击。IPFS的存储方法是分散的,文件分散存储,不能被黑客攻击,文件不易丢失,并且可以保证安全性。
2)效率:HTTP依赖于集中式服务器网络,服务器易于关闭,服务器上的文件也易于删除,并且服务器需要开启24小时。IPFS使用P2P网络拓扑,整个网络中的计算机都可以成为存储节点,并且附近的分布式存储大大提高了网络效率。
3)成本:HTTP集中式服务器操作需要很高的维护和运营成本。一旦集中式数据库遭到DDOS攻击或由于不可抗力而损坏,所有数据将丢失。IPFS大大降低了服务器存储成本,还降低了服务器带宽成本。
4)DNS加速:大多数HTTP客户端网络访问未本地化,并且存在网络延迟。IPFS可以大大加快网络访问的速度,网络访问的本地化,并且体验将得到显着改善。
另一方面,我们经常说IPFS是分布式存储,但实际上它很小。IPFS是一种协议。从技术角度来看,我们习惯称其为协议范围。它由多种协议组成。从严格意义上讲,存储只是其功能的1/3。
IPFS的另一个功能是数据分发。实际上,在IPFS协议的范围内,IPFS的P2P穿透了不同的网络来分发内容。它诞生了一个P2P网络和一个CDN,解决了内容分发的问题。无论是Web1.0还是2.0,甚至是Web3.0,IPFS实际上都具有更大的数据权限和传输量。通过P2P可以节省近60%的网络带宽,这一点非常重要。
此外,除了数据分发外,还进行了加密。当我们将数据上传到IPFS网络时,它不仅可以存储,而且安全可靠。IPFS加密协议还可以确保安全性和可靠性。只有存储大量数据并对其进行安全加密,才能确保其在Web3.0中的真实健康发展。
甚至Filecoin是IPFS的激励层,也是其功能之一。可以说,除了定义协议之外,IPFS还完成了全部工作。
通常,IPFS分布式技术实际上是构建Web3.0的非常基本的事情。它允许我们以分布式方式对数据进行切片,加密和存储。它使我们存储的数据更安全,并允许我们存储数据。隐私性更好,因此当我们在该网络上进行某些工作或提供服务时,我们的权利可以得到保护。这也是IPFS可以做出的最基本的Web3.0贡献。
每个阶段都有其必须出现的原因。从0-1阶段开始的Internet是Web1.0阶段,它解决了我们的数据传输效率问题,但是在此过程中,我们的网民没有参与交互。在Web2.0阶段,它是一个交互式网络。此时,客户可以以这种方式参与网络。一种动机和开放性可能正在增加,这导致了近年来互联网的快速发展。
在此过程中,我们为我们提供了许多有效的数据,但我们的意识也在提高。我们会发现我们在Internet上生成了许多有价值的数据和信息,但是我们访问它们的权利似乎并不公平。因此,每个人都期待更好的网络分布和更好的数据采集。在这个大时代,Web3.0不会失败。这也是Web3.0出现的最大时代背景。